Black Book introduced the industry's first electric vehicle valuations under Battery Adjusted Values, based on information from Recurrent

On January 23, Black Book introduced the industry’s first electric vehicle (EV) valuations under Battery Adjusted Values. These values include battery modifications based on information from Recurrent, a leading authority in EV analytics. Battery Adjusted Values will apply an additional increase or decrease to Black Book’s industry-leading, VIN-specific valuations using battery condition. Read More

Cadillac is launching two new V-Series models, this time with a greater emphasis on performance and advanced technology.

Cadillac has shared details of the upcoming CT5-V and CT5-V Blackwing, two luxury sedans targeted toward tech-savvy and performance-focused buyers. The two vehicles signify 20 years of Cadillac’s V-Series, which celebrated a record-breaking year in 2023. Similar to previous models, the CT5-V and CT5-V Blackwing deliver on performance, handling, and design, but place a stronger emphasis on software and functionalityRead More
